Ethan Shanfeld Barbra Streisand may be changing her tune on Bradley Cooper and Lady Gaga’s “A Star Is Born.”The singer and actor, who starred in the 1976 version of “A Star Is Born,” said in a new interview about the 2018 remake, “At first, when I heard it was going to be done again, it was supposed to be Will Smith and Beyoncé, and I thought, that’s interesting. Really make it different again, different kind of music, integrated actors, I thought that was a great idea.
